             Photographs include Sitka, Tlingit Indian culture, Russian Orthodox Church and schools, ca. 1897-1929.E. W. Merrill photographs are found in many Northwest collections, but original glass plates are located at the U.S. National Park Service and Sheldon Jackson College at Sitka.  There are approximately 200 glass plates at the Park Service and about 900 at Sheldon Jackson.In 1978, the National Park Service's Merrill collection was copied in a cooperative project with...
